This is a rather well made study piece, reminiscent of the works of the old masters. As such, it's strengths are not in it's character or subject, but in it's technique and execution. In comparison to the original, the subject seems to be happier, yet due to the lack of stronger lines, more ethereal. The lighting and shadows are very well executed, yet the area around the forward facing eye appears slightly weak. From that one point, a disruptive effect seems to radiate outwards. In a sense, this can be said to add a degree of uniqueness to the art, beyond just a simple imitation. The artist clearly has a good degree of background and respect for the original piece, and shows an advanced level of skill in replicating the main aspects of said original. As stated before, it is well done as a study, and a testament to the artist's skill, but lacks slightly in the artist's own personal flair for the sake of authenticity.
